NileGuide Expert Says:
If you don't have time to get out to the mountains for some cross-country, COP is a really great track and very convenient. Although it's not the toughest track in Alberta, it's still a good workout.
NileGuide Expert tip:
Cross-country tickets cost between $12-$20 for adults and about the same for rental equipment. You can also rent gear from a few stores in Calgary, such as the Outdoor Centre at the U of C, but the price at COP is fair.
Description:
- Open from November to April, this 2km track is perfect for any level of cross-country skier, and the track is lit so it is open for both day and night time (to 9PM) skiing. Expert instructors are available for lessons, and this is one of the best tracks to learn on in Calgary. It's very easy to get to COP, and it's only a few minutes from Downtown.
